About Our Statue:

This magnificent handcrafted copper Manjushri statue captures the divine essence of the Bodhisattva of Wisdom, standing 14cm tall and 10cm wide. The sculpture features intricate copper craftsmanship showcasing Manjushri wielding the flaming sword of transcendent knowledge in his raised right hand, symbolizing the cutting through of ignorance. His left hand holds a sacred lotus flower bearing the Perfection of Wisdom scripture, embodying spiritual enlightenment. The deity wears an ornate crown embellished with elaborate floral motifs and jeweled details, with intricate facial features displaying serene compassion. Seated upon a beautifully carved lotus pedestal base featuring traditional petal designs, this wisdom Buddha idol weighs 0.48kg, providing excellent presence for any sacred space. The detailed serpent motifs and ornamental scrollwork frame the entire figure with masterful craftsmanship.

Manjushri represents ultimate knowledge and insight within Tibetan Buddhism and Mahayana traditions, making this sacred altar statue ideal for meditation practitioners. How do you take care of your statues?

Place them at room temperature, avoiding direct sunlight.
Ensure that the area where your statue is placed is entirely free of moisture and dust.
Place it at the highest place on your altar after being consecrated by a Lama/monks. The best practice is to keep them covered inside a glass cabinet.
Do not use your bare hands or any objects with rough surfaces to wipe your face. Directly touching objects with the bare hand can smudge the face, leaving scratches.
